a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.gitignore1
-rw-r--r--scripts/jenkins_jobs.ini.example6
-rw-r--r--scripts/osmocom-nightly-nitb-split.yml20
3 files changed, 27 insertions, 0 deletions
diff --git a/.gitignore b/.gitignore
index 4e25b2f..4163eb6 100644
--- a/.gitignore
+++ b/.gitignore
@@ -3,3 +3,4 @@ source-*
install-*
tokens.txt
.*.sw?
+jenkins_jobs.ini
diff --git a/scripts/jenkins_jobs.ini.example b/scripts/jenkins_jobs.ini.example
new file mode 100644
index 0000000..639b399
--- /dev/null
+++ b/scripts/jenkins_jobs.ini.example
@@ -0,0 +1,6 @@
+[jenkins]
+user=example
+# To get a token: Go to Jenkins via Web -> Login -> Press up right Corner on your Username -> Configure -> API token in the body
+password=get_a_token
+url=https://jenkins.osmocom.org/jenkins
+query_plugins_info=False
diff --git a/scripts/osmocom-nightly-nitb-split.yml b/scripts/osmocom-nightly-nitb-split.yml
new file mode 100644
index 0000000..6c264fd
--- /dev/null
+++ b/scripts/osmocom-nightly-nitb-split.yml
@@ -0,0 +1,20 @@
+---
+- project:
+ name: Osmocom_nightly_nitb_split
+ jobs:
+ - Osmocom_nightly_nitb_split
+
+- job:
+ name: 'Osmocom_nightly_nitb_split'
+ project-type: freestyle
+ defaults: global
+ description: 'Generated by job-builder'
+ node: linux_amd64_debian8
+ builders:
+ - shell:
+ ./scripts/osmocom-nightly-nitb-split.sh
+ scm:
+ - git:
+ url: git://git.osmocom.org/osmo-ci
+ git-config-name: 'Jenkins Builder'
+ git-config-email: 'jenkins@osmocom.org